ST2/MONITOR module

1
PFL indicator
This indicator (yellow) will light when the PFL switch of one or more mod-
ules is turned on.
2
2TR IN switch
This switch selects the 2TR IN input signal. This signal will be sent to the
headphone jack and to the ST2/MONI OUT jack. When this switch is on,
the 2TR IN input signal will be sent regardless of each module's PFL and
AFL switch settings.
3
MONI/ST2 switch
This switch selects the signal that is output to the ST2/MONI OUT jack.
When the switch is in the "ST2" position, the signal will be the same as the
signal that is sent to the ST1 OUT jack. When the switch is in the "MONI"
position, the signal will be taken from the PFL bus, AFL bus, or the 2TR IN
jack.
4
ON switch
This switch turns the ST2/MONITOR module on/off. When the switch is
pressed in the module is on. When the module is off, no signal will be output
from the ST2/MONI OUT jack.
5
L+R switch
This switch causes a mono mixed signal to be output from the ST2/MONI
OUT jack.
6
ST2/MONITOR fader
This fader controls the signal level of the ST2/MONITOR output.
